How much does a Neurosurgeon make in Danbury, CT? The average Neurosurgeon salary in Danbury, CT is $745,701 as of April 24, 2024, but the range typically falls between $561,401 and $943,501.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on many important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, the number of years you have spent in your profession. Neurosurgeon Salaries by Percentile
Percentile Salary Location Last Updated
10th Percentile Neurosurgeon Salary $393,605 Danbury,CT April 24, 2024
25th Percentile Neurosurgeon Salary $561,401 Danbury,CT April 24, 2024
50th Percentile Neurosurgeon Salary $745,701 Danbury,CT April 24, 2024
75th Percentile Neurosurgeon Salary $943,501 Danbury,CT April 24, 2024
90th Percentile Neurosurgeon Salary $1,123,588 Danbury,CT April 24, 2024

Job Description

The Neurosurgeon operates on the brain in order to relieve pressure in an intracranial hemorrhage, remove a foreign body such as a tumor, treat a wound, or relieve pain. Examines, diagnoses, and surgically treats disorders of the brain, spine, spinal cord, and nerves. Being a Neurosurgeon reviews patient history and confirms need for surgery. Operates on the spine in order to free entrapped nerves, correct deformity, or restore spinal stability. In addition, Neurosurgeon determines which instruments and method of surgery will be most successful in achieving desired outcome. May provide medical personnel with direction concerning patient care. May provide in-service training as needed to address new technology in health care treatment. Provides charting in compliance with all laws and regulations. Requires a special degree in medicine from an accredited school. Typically reports to the chief of surgery. Requires a license to practice. Neurosurgeon's years of experience requirement may be unspecified. Certification and/or licensing in the position's specialty is the main requirement. These charts show the average base salary (core compensation), as well as the average total cash compensation for the job of Neurosurgeon in Danbury, CT. The base salary for Neurosurgeon ranges from $561,401 to $943,501 with the average base salary of $745,701. The total cash compensation, which includes base, and annual incentives, can vary anywhere from $597,501 to $987,801 with the average total cash compensation of $776,101.
